Public invited to collaborate on State Prison reimagination
MICHIGAN CITY, Ind. – The community is encouraged to offer input on the reuse and reimagining of the Indiana State Prison site from 6:30 to 8 p.m. on Wednesday, Jan. 22 at the Michigan City H.O.P.E.
